Windows
To manage privacy settings on your Windows 11 device, go to Start
> Settings
> Privacy & security, or on your Windows 10 device, go to Start
> Settings
> Privacy.
Microsoft Edge
Select Settings and more
> Settings
> Privacy, search, and services. To learn more about other ways to protect your privacy in Microsoft Edge, visit the Privacy in Microsoft Edge support page.

Microsoft 365
Manage your privacy settings in any Microsoft 365 app by going to File > Options > Trust Center > Trust Center Settings > Privacy Options. To learn more, check out our step-by-step guide.
Microsoft Teams
For Teams privacy settings on both your browser and app, go to Settings and more
> Settings
> Privacy. You can also export your personal Teams data.
Skype
Select your profile picture and then select Settings
> Privacy. Find answers to your Skype privacy questions. You can also export and delete your personal Skype data.

Outlook.com
To manage your privacy on Outlook.com, go to Settings
> General > Privacy and data. You can also import and export your Outlook email, contacts, and calendar.
